Overview

#B65998 is a warm, light color. In RGB it is 182, 89, 152, in HSL 319.4°, 38.9%, 53.1%, and in CMYK 0.0%, 51.1%, 16.5%, 28.6%. The nearest named color is Mulberry.

Color Psychology

Magenta is a stimulating, attention-commanding color that bridges passion and imagination. It represents transformation, artistic vision, and unconventional thinking. Magenta disrupts expectations and is associated with innovation and bold self-expression.

Design Usage

Medium magentas are powerful for brands that want to project creativity and boldness. They create eye-catching gradients when blended with purple or orange tones. Use sparingly as accent colors for maximum impact in otherwise restrained designs.
